24 Aug 2026, 11:00 PMThe Register7.0 What Nvidia's first Groq 3 LPU benchmarks do and don't tell us about its $20B gamble

Nvidia's first independent benchmarks for its Groq 3-based LPX racks show 3,400 tokens/second on Gemma 4 31B with 100K-token input, roughly 4x faster than Cerebras' 882 tok/s. The architecture trades capacity for speed: each LPU has only 500 MB of on-die SRAM (vs 288 GB on Rubin GPUs) but 150 TB/s of bandwidth, requiring models to be distributed across up to 256 LPUs per rack via Ethernet. Nebius will be among the first neoclouds to deploy the combined GPU-LPU systems.

Why: If you're building AI agents, inference throughput directly constrains how long models can reason and how many agent turns are feasible within a time budget. The 3,400 tok/s figure is a best-case benchmark on a specific model, not a guarantee for your workload, but it signals that agentic inference economics are shifting toward speed-at-a-premium. Builders evaluating neocloud providers like Nebius for inference serving should track whether LPX-class throughput justifies the cost for their agent architectures rather than assuming GPU-only deployments.
